Steps to Obtain An Italian Driving License Without an Exam
While the treatment for getting an Italian driving license without an exam varies depending on the candidate's situations, the basic steps are as follows:
1. Validate Eligibility
Individuals need to confirm that they fall under one of the abovementioned classifications that allow for license exchange without evaluation. It is recommended to contact regional authorities regarding any particular arrangements that might use.
2. Collect Necessary Documentation
The required documentation generally consists of:
- A valid foreign driving license
- Evidence of identity (passport or ID card)
- Proof of residence in Italy (energy expense or residence certificate)
- Recent passport-sized pictures
- A medical certificate attesting to the candidate's physical fitness to drive (if required)
3. Visit the Local Motorizzazione Civile
The Motorizzazione Civile, Italy's department of motor automobiles, is where applicants should present their paperwork to look for the license exchange.
4. Complete the Application Form
Fill out the required application kind provided by the local workplace. Ensure all info is accurate and total.

5. Pay Applicable Fees
There are various costs related to the application process, consisting of administrative charges and expenses for photographs and medical exams.
6. Wait for Processing
When the application is submitted, it will be processed. The timeline for receiving the new license can vary based on the regional office's workload.
7. Receive the License
When approved, the applicant will get their Italian driving license, enabling them to drive legally in Italy.

Typical FAQs about Obtaining an Italian Driving License Without an Exam
1. Do I need to take a driving test if I have a valid EU driving license?
No, EU citizens with a legitimate driving license typically do not need to take a driving test to obtain an Italian driving license.
2. What if my foreign driving license has ended?
An expired driving license may not be eligible for exchange. It is advised to renew your foreign license before applying.
3. The length of time does it take to get an Italian driving license after applying?
Processing times can differ; nevertheless, candidates can typically anticipate to receive their license within 30 to 90 days.
4. Can I drive with a foreign license in Italy?
Yes, people can drive in Italy with a legitimate foreign driving license for up to one year of residency. After this period, an Italian license is needed.
5. Exist any nations that have unique arrangements with Italy for driving license exchanges?
Yes, several countries, including some non-EU nations, have bilateral agreements with Italy that may enable direct exchange without examinations.
